A Mysterious Villain Emerges in Korea's Hottest Cop Comedy 🎬
The second season of SBS's beloved procedural comedy-drama "Flex x Cop" is ramping up the stakes with a thrilling guest appearance that promises to shake things up. Actor Lee Hak Joo is stepping into the spotlight with a special role that showcases his ability to command the screen with an unsettling, sinister presence—a stark contrast to the show's lighthearted tone.
As the series progresses into its third episode, viewers can expect an injection of genuine tension and intrigue. Lee Hak Joo's casting marks a significant shift in the show's narrative momentum, introducing an element of danger that will keep audiences on the edge of their seats.
The Cast Returns Stronger Than Ever 🌟
Ahn Bo Hyun continues his charismatic performance as Jin Yi Soo, the unconventional detective protagonist who leverages his third-generation chaebol background to solve crimes. His character's unique approach—using wealth, connections, and privilege as investigative tools—has become the show's signature appeal. Alongside him, Jung Eun Chae brings seasoned professionalism to her role as Joo Hye Ra, the veteran detective paired with Jin Yi Soo.

The chemistry between the two leads has been a cornerstone of the series' success, and their dynamic continues to drive the show's narrative forward. Their partnership creates the perfect backdrop for introducing more complex antagonists and morally ambiguous characters.
Lee Hak Joo's Chilling Performance 💫
In freshly released promotional stills, Lee Hak Joo emerges as a formidable screen presence. Set against the ominous backdrop of a dark, seemingly endless reservoir, his character exudes an air of menace and mystery. His piercing gaze, combined with visible facial scars and a tight-lipped expression, immediately signals that this is not a character to be underestimated.
This visual presentation is deliberately crafted to unsettle viewers and create an atmosphere of dread. The production team has clearly invested thought into how Lee Hak Joo's appearance and demeanor will contrast with the show's typically comedic tone, making his presence all the more impactful.

The Strategic Timing of Episode 3 ⏰
Episode 3 traditionally serves as a critical juncture in television storytelling. By episode three, viewers have invested enough time to care about the characters, yet the narrative remains open enough for significant plot twists. Introducing a menacing new character at this precise moment demonstrates savvy storytelling instincts from the production team.
The episode will air on August 14 at 9:50 p.m. KST, during prime time—a slot reserved for content that networks believe will draw substantial viewership.
